Test & Evaluation Specialist jobs in United States
cer-icon
Apply on Employer Site
company-logo

Agile Defense · 2 months ago

Test & Evaluation Specialist

Agile Defense is committed to embracing change and providing innovative solutions to support national missions. The Test & Evaluation Specialist will produce and maintain test scripts, collaborate with teams to ensure quality software solutions, and participate in various agile ceremonies to enhance testing processes.

Information ServicesInformation TechnologySoftware
check
Growth Opportunities
badNo H1BnoteU.S. Citizen Onlynote

Responsibilities

Produce quality and maintainable test scripts
Work closely with business analysts and subject matter experts to understand requirements and translate to software solutions. Collaborate with business analysts and developers to fully understand the full scope and impact of each story to the test scenario
Create and update automated test scripts based upon developed agile stories using Selenium
Create ad-hoc tests using SoapUI and other tools to work through new scenarios
Create and maintain tests using SoapUI and other tools to work through new scenarios
Work with teams to effectively design, build, and deliver cloud-based solutions
Participate in design meetings with other projects and the client’s technical specialists
Work with other teams to coordinate integration testing across multiple (more than 3) teams
Participate in daily stand-ups, backlog grooming, sprint demos, and other agile ceremonies
Estimate test case writing and execution effort and track progress
Design and execute performance tests that provide meaningful results to developers on areas of enhancement
Develop code-based test scripts using TypeScript and hold test case reviews with stakeholders
Execute test cases including functional, regression, performance, load and smoke tests for both web applications and database
Report defects, track, validate, and close
Record test results and report them
Support 508 compliance test execution and documentation
Identify regression test candidates for automation, plan automation activities across the team and automate test cases
Support and improve the overall system
Participate in daily scrum meetings, agile ceremonies, and weekly test team meetings
Participate in all phases of risk management assessments and software development with emphasis on analysis of user requirements, test design and test tools selection
Install, maintain, or use software testing programs
Support and track and gather metrics on all activities
Support UAT activities
Support end of sprint demos, user acceptance testing, and solicit feedback on test artifacts and processes
Knowledge of RESTful API-based applications
Experience in Manual Test Script Development and Execution
Proven experience with the following technologies:
Experience with Selenium, Serenity, or Cucumber
TypeScript/JavaScript
TestCafe or similar framework
AWS
HTML and DOM object identification
Chrome Dev Tools
NPM and Node.js and capability of managing npm packages and versions
Accessibility testing
Development Methodologies: Test Driven Development, Agile Software Delivery, Scrum, Continuous Integration/Continuous Deployment
5+ years of development experience in the Information Technology field focusing on development projects using DevSecOps
Minimum of five (5) years of experience in writing and testing enterprise software solutions. A degree in Computer Science and three (3) years of experience is also acceptable
Minimum of three (3) years of experience in automation framework development and troubleshooting software
Experience working in AWS, software containerization and Agile development processes
Experience with JSON
Expert skills in test automation tools including TestCafe
Knowledge of RESTful API-based applications
Experience working in an Agile environment
Strong analytical and problem solving skills
Strong communication skills

Qualification

SeleniumTypeScriptTest AutomationAWSAgile DevelopmentRESTful APIsTestCafeAnalytical SkillsAccessibility TestingManual TestingCommunication

Required

Public Trust clearance requires a background investigation (BI) and entry on duty (EOD) status
Produce quality and maintainable test scripts
Work closely with business analysts and subject matter experts to understand requirements and translate to software solutions
Collaborate with business analysts and developers to fully understand the full scope and impact of each story to the test scenario
Create and update automated test scripts based upon developed agile stories using Selenium
Create ad-hoc tests using SoapUI and other tools to work through new scenarios
Create and maintain tests using SoapUI and other tools to work through new scenarios
Work with teams to effectively design, build, and deliver cloud-based solutions
Participate in design meetings with other projects and the client's technical specialists
Work with other teams to coordinate integration testing across multiple (more than 3) teams
Participate in daily stand-ups, backlog grooming, sprint demos, and other agile ceremonies
Estimate test case writing and execution effort and track progress
Design and execute performance tests that provide meaningful results to developers on areas of enhancement
Develop code-based test scripts using TypeScript and hold test case reviews with stakeholders
Execute test cases including functional, regression, performance, load and smoke tests for both web applications and database
Report defects, track, validate, and close
Record test results and report them
Support 508 compliance test execution and documentation
Identify regression test candidates for automation, plan automation activities across the team and automate test cases
Support and improve the overall system
Participate in daily scrum meetings, agile ceremonies, and weekly test team meetings
Participate in all phases of risk management assessments and software development with emphasis on analysis of user requirements, test design and test tools selection
Install, maintain, or use software testing programs
Support and track and gather metrics on all activities
Support UAT activities
Support end of sprint demos, user acceptance testing, and solicit feedback on test artifacts and processes
Knowledge of RESTful API-based applications
Experience in Manual Test Script Development and Execution
Proven experience with the following technologies:
Experience with Selenium, Serenity, or Cucumber
TypeScript/JavaScript
TestCafe or similar framework
AWS
HTML and DOM object identification
Chrome Dev Tools
NPM and Node.js and capability of managing npm packages and versions
Accessibility testing
Development Methodologies: Test Driven Development, Agile Software Delivery, Scrum, Continuous Integration/Continuous Deployment
5+ years of development experience in the Information Technology field focusing on development projects using DevSecOps
Minimum of five (5) years of experience in writing and testing enterprise software solutions
A degree in Computer Science and three (3) years of experience is also acceptable
Minimum of three (3) years of experience in automation framework development and troubleshooting software
Experience working in AWS, software containerization and Agile development processes
Experience with JSON
Expert skills in test automation tools including TestCafe
Knowledge of RESTful API-based applications
Experience working in an Agile environment
Strong analytical and problem solving skills
Strong communication skills

Preferred

Candidates with existing or recently completed Public Trust background investigations are preferred

Company

Agile Defense

twittertwittertwitter
company-logo
Agile Defense is an information technology company located in Reston. It is a sub-organization of Agile-BOT.

Funding

Current Stage
Late Stage
Total Funding
unknown
2022-11-16Acquired

Leadership Team

leader-logo
Rick Wagner
Chief Executive Officer
linkedin
B
Bill Luebke
Chief Financial Officer
linkedin
Company data provided by crunchbase